On May 22, 2025, the New York City Council approved a spot rezoning of 2201-2227 Neptune Avenue in Coney Island, Brooklyn, changing the zoning from M1-2 to an MX Special Mixed-Use District (M1-5/R7-3) and applying Mandatory Inclusionary Housing requirements. The rezoning authorizes up to a 6.0 FAR to facilitate a new mixed-use development that combines ground-floor commercial and retail space with upper-story residential units, while retaining an existing shelter. The action includes changes to height and setback regulations, allows a wider range of uses—including retail, office, light industrial, community facility, and residential—and introduces inclusionary housing incentives to produce affordable units. The amendment is part of the city’s ongoing waterfront revitalization and housing production strategy, targeting underutilized industrial properties for higher-density, mixed-income redevelopment.
